Instructions for Turkey Meatballs
- Prep Your Ingredients: Gather all ingredients needed for the turkey meatballs and dipping sauces.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Set out a large mixing bowl, a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, and measuring tools.
- Mix Meatball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ine ground turkey, grated onion, breadcrumbs, oats, Worcestershire sauce, kosher salt, and ground black pepper. Mix gently until just combined.
- Shape the Meatballs: Roll the turkey mixture into small balls, about 1.5 inches in diameter, and place them on the baking sheet, spaced about an inch apart.
- Bake the Meatballs: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until golden brown and the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).
- Prepare Dipping Sauces: Whisk together soy sauce, mirin, light brown sugar, freshly grated ginger, grated garlic, cornstarch, and water in a saucepan over medium heat until it thickens.
- For the lemon-herb yogurt sauce, mix Greek yogurt, lemon zest, lemon juice, chopped parsley, chopped dill, salt, and black pepper in a bowl until smooth.
- Serve and Enjoy: Serve the meatballs hot with both dipping sauces.

Notes
These turkey meatballs can be stored in the fridge for up to 3 days or frozen for up to 3 months. Reheat in the oven or microwave for best results.
